You need to enable JavaScript to run this app.
最新活动
大模型
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

Flatpak Hub提供Ubuntu默认仓库未推送的系统更新的原因及安全性咨询

Flatpak Hub提供Ubuntu默认仓库未推送的系统更新的原因及安全性咨询

嗨,我来帮你把这个问题掰扯清楚~

为什么Flatpak Hub有这个更新,Ubuntu默认仓库却没有?

其实你看到的Flatpak Hub里的“系统更新”,并不是Ubuntu官方的系统包更新,而是Flatpak生态自己的「运行时环境(Runtime)」更新,这俩完全是两码事:

  • Ubuntu默认仓库(apt源)推送的是Ubuntu发行版本身的核心组件更新,比如内核、系统库、桌面套件这些,都是Ubuntu官方团队维护的,遵循Ubuntu的稳定更新策略——比如LTS版本只会推安全补丁和小版本修复,不会随便升级大版本的组件(比如从GNOME 42跳到44)。
  • Flatpak有一套独立的运行时体系,比如Freedesktop Platform、GNOME Runtime这些,是由Flatpak项目或者对应的桌面环境团队(比如GNOME基金会)维护的,更新周期和内容完全独立于Ubuntu。它们的作用是给Flatpak应用提供统一的运行环境,让应用在不同发行版上都能正常运行,所以会根据自身的开发节奏推送更新,哪怕你的Ubuntu系统本身没更新,Flatpak的运行时也会有新版本。
  • 简单说就是:两个更新源属于完全独立的生态,各自管各自的东西,出现一方有更新另一方没有是非常正常的情况。

这个更新安全吗?

如果是从**官方Flatpak Hub(Flathub)**获取的更新,那完全不用担心安全性:

  • Flathub的所有应用和运行时都经过了官方审核流程,恶意内容很难混进去;
  • Flatpak本身有严格的沙箱机制,运行时的更新只会在Flatpak的沙箱环境里生效,不会触及Ubuntu系统的核心组件,就算出了问题也只会影响Flatpak应用,不会搞坏你的整个系统;
  • 这种更新本质上是为了让你的Flatpak应用获得更好的兼容性、新功能和安全补丁,反而能提升Flatpak应用的使用体验。

当然,如果你之前添加的是非官方的Flatpak仓库,那就要多留个心眼了,但既然你说的是Flatpak Hub(官方源),那就放心更就行。

备注:内容来源于stack exchange,提问作者Pontifex Maximus

火山引擎 最新活动